3D printers are a revolutionary product. With so many printing possibilities, they can be easily used for good or bad. Uses include car manufacturing, space exploration, shoe design and education.

 

Aside from all the fun, 3D printers have created some more serious implications. When used in medicine, the results can be spectacular. Not only are printed materials used for implants (pelvic and tracheal), but 3D-printed prosthetics and organ printing are simply spectacular. China has even committed nearly $500 million towards national 3D printing development institutes, showing the importance it could have on commercial manufacturing.

 

However, using techniques to print guns is what is on the opposite side of the spectrum. While not being as durable as “real” weapons, the question remains of how easily can a person or group of people print off a bunch of guns, and easily dispose of them after use?

 

As with any new technology there is controversy, however 3D printers have seemingly been used for the betterment of society in their short existence. Hopefully, they continue to challenge commercial norms and eventually bring costs for things like prosthetics down, while increasing availability.
